Like all mechanical problems, catching them early can save you time and money. With this in mind, here are some of the most common signs of the need for automatic transmission repair.

Your car’s transmission has been designed to transfer engine power to the drive shafts and wheels as quickly as possible. However, if you step on the gas pedal, and there is a moment’s hesitation before the car shifts, then you likely have a gear going bad or the beginning of other transmission problems.

Do you hear strange sounds when you drive?  Although the noise varies depending on the size of the vehicle, the model, and even the model, these specific sounds can not be missed. Because they are often the result of malfunctions in metal parts, you will hear a loud buzzing, buzzing, whining or
humming sound. Noise can occur at regular or irregular intervals and almost always gets worse the longer you drive. And the problem can quickly spread throughout the system.

Check Your Transmission Fluid

One of the most common causes of transmission problems is due to your car or truck’s transmission fluid.  If you have a transmission fluid leak, or transmission fluid that needs to be replaced, it will show in the performance of your transmission.  You can tell if you have a leak by looking for spots where you park your vehicle.  Transmission fluid has very different colors than something like motor oil.  Usually transmission has a sweet smell, and is almost blood red or purple in color.

Your car’s transmission is a sealed system.  As such, the level of transmission fluid should remain constant.  If you find you are low on transmission fluid, then it’s likely that there is a leak somewhere.  But before you just add transmission fluid, take it in to a transmission repair shop in Mesa to avoid other problems.
